Step 4. Positioning, Leveling, and
Securing the Fireplace
The diagram below shows how to properly position, level,
and secure the fireplace.
WARNING:
To ensure proper clearances
the front framing header
must be installed on its
narrow edge and to the
front of the frame.
NAILING TABS
(BOTH SIDES)
Figure 32. Proper Positioning, Leveling, and
Securing of a Fireplace
• Place the fireplace into position.
• Level the fireplace from side to side and from front to
back.
• Shim the fireplace with non-combustible material, such
as sheet metal, as necessary.
• Secure the fireplace to the framing using nails or screws
through the nailing tabs.
Step 5. The Gas Control Systems
WARNING: THIS UNIT IS NOT FOR USE WITH
!
SOLID FUEL.
Two types of gas control systems are used with this model:
Standing Pilot Ignition and Intermittent Pilot Ignition (IPI).
Standing Pilot Ignition System
This system includes millivolt control valve, standing pilot,
thermopile/thermocouple flame sensor, and piezo ignitor.
WARNING: 1 10-120 VAC MUST NEVER BE
!
CONNECTED TO A CONTROL VALVE IN A
MILLIVOLT SYSTEM.
Figure 33. Gas Control Systems
Intermittent Pilot Ignition (IPI) System
This system includes a 3V control valve, electronic
module and intermittent pilot.
WARNING: CONTINUOUS 1 10-120 VAC
!
SERVICE MUST BE WIRED DIRECTLY TO
THE FIREPLACE JUNCTION BOX IN A IPI SYSTEM.
